The return of the NIKE AIR MAX 180 has been a somewhat-refined affair, with several great colourways quietly dropping over the past few months. This new Desert Sand edition shows the classic running design in a slightly different light – one that we like a lot – so we picked up a pair to see how they looked on-foot…

An incredible shoe from the combined minds of both Tinker Hatfield and Bruce Kilgore, the launch campaign surrounding the Air Max 180 back in 1991 was perhaps one of the most memorable in modern history. Ralph Steadman’s amazing inky illustrations, some clever taglines and bold identity and layout work from Wieden + Kennedy provided the fanfare for this sleek, aerodynamic running shoe with the first 180-degree visible Air bubble. The 180 has reappeared several times since its debut, but remains a relatively unsung member of the Air Max family, especially when compared to other models such as the Air Max 1 or Air Max 90. Where some shoes struggle with making the leap from performance to lifestyle, the 180 has managed this easily – and this new Desert Sand colourway proves it once again. Featuring tumbled leather panels on top of a textile layer, it could easily be mistaken as a collaboration release. Comfortable, lightweight and smart, the 180 is one shoe that needs to be explored further.
